The CPK isoenzymes test is a way to measure the levels of this enzyme in your … WebCK is released from the damaged myocardial cells. In early cases, a rise in the CK activity can be found just 4 hours after an infarction, the CK-activities reaches a maximum after 12-24 hours and then falls back to the normal range after 3-4 days. Web3- The CK-MB percentage is found between the 6-20% of the total CK value. If the percentage is bellow 6% there is probably damage to the skeletal muscle. If the percentage is over 20% of the total CK value the presence of a macro kind of CK (atypical CK) which is not inhibited by the anti-CK-M antibodies, can be suspected.
